Saturday, March 27, 2004
PITTSBURGH (AP) -- Konstantin Koltsov's goal late in the second period helped the Pittsburgh Penguins rally for a 2-2 tie with Buffalo on Saturday night, damaging the Sabres' slim playoff hopes. Koltsov converted Tom Kostopoulos' pass at 15:28 of the second period for his ninth goal of the season as Pittsburgh overcame a 2-0 deficit to extend its home unbeaten streak to seven (5-0-2).
